A report this week from WDBJ7 draws attention to a consequence of Arizona's brutal summer heat that often goes undiscussed: the measurable stress being placed on the state's native wildlife. While human health impacts during Arizona heat events dominate headlines, biologists and wildlife managers are documenting distress across multiple species as temperatures in the Sonoran and Mojave Desert regions push into record territory.
Arizona Game and Fish Department officials have noted that water sources critical to desert wildlife — from mule deer and javelinas to raptors and reptiles — are drying up faster than normal during the current heat cycle. Animals that would ordinarily range widely in search of food are increasingly clustering around remaining water catchments and urban water features, a behavioral shift that puts them in greater contact with humans and domestic animals and raises the risk of vehicle collisions on roads cutting through habitat corridors across Maricopa, Pima, and Yavapai counties.
Smaller species are showing particular vulnerability. Bird mortality events have been observed in the lower Colorado River basin, and herpetologists monitoring Gila monsters and desert tortoises in the Tucson Basin have flagged unusual surface activity during daylight hours — behavior typically associated with thermal stress — as animals seek shade or moisture in suboptimal conditions. The compounding factor is that nighttime low temperatures across metro Phoenix have frequently remained above 90°F in recent weeks, denying nocturnal animals the cooler hours they depend on for foraging.
Researchers affiliated with Arizona State University's Global Institute of Sustainability and Innovation point out that this pattern is consistent with multi-year projections that anticipated accelerating heat stress on Sonoran Desert food webs as climate baselines shift upward. The strain on primary consumers like insects and small mammals has downstream effects on raptors, coyotes, and other predators that form the upper layers of Arizona's desert ecosystems.
For Arizonans who maintain rural or semi-rural properties, the convergence of stressed wildlife, degraded natural water sources, and a strained electrical grid — APS and SRP have both logged near-record demand loads this summer — creates a layered set of conditions worth understanding. Water storage infrastructure in the state, including CAP canal deliveries and local groundwater dependent on functioning pump systems, sits within the same vulnerability window as the wildlife it indirectly supports; extended grid disruption during peak heat would affect not just households but the agricultural and municipal water systems that form the backbone of Arizona's human and ecological communities.
